Introduction à la Navigation avec Flex
Objectifs
Comprendre et utiliser les containers Accordéon, TabNavigator et ViewStack dans Flex pour naviguer entre des composants.
Résumé
Apprenez à utiliser les containers Flex NavigatorContent, Accordéon, TabNavigator et ViewStack pour faciliter la navigation entre différents composants.
Description
Dans cette leçon, nous explorons différentes méthodes pour gérer la navigation entre plusieurs composants dans une application Flex. Nous commençons par créer trois pages : About, Contact et Home, chacune de type NavigatorContent. Cette structure permet de les inclure dans des navigateurs tels que Accordéon, TabNavigator ou ViewStack.
Tout d'abord, nous utilisons le container Accordéon pour organiser nos pages en sections repliables. En entourant les composants avec la balise Accordéon et en définissant des propriétés Label, nous pouvons facilement naviguer entre les pages grâce aux titres des boutons.
Ensuite, nous remplaçons l'Accordéon par un TabNavigator, permettant une navigation par onglets. Le principe reste le même : les composants sont inclus dans la balise TabNavigator et les titres des onglets sont définis par les Labels des composants.
Enfin, nous explorons l'utilisation du ViewStack, un conteneur qui empile les vues et permet une navigation via divers éléments comme ButtonBar ou LinkBar. Nous associons ici une TabBar au ViewStack pour gérer la navigation, en liant leurs ID et DataProvider respectifs.
Cet apprentissage pratique permet de choisir le bon outil de navigation selon les besoins de votre application Flex, en offrant une expérience utilisateur intuitive et structurée.